Table 2.
The AUCs and Youden Index based thresholdsa
MSE | AUC (95%-CI) | Threshold | Sensitivity (%) | Specificity (%) | PPV (%) | NPV (%) | Accuracy (%) |
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
abp | 0.80 (0.74–0.85) | 22.3 | 65 | 80 | 68 | 77 | 74 |
sbp | 0.82 (0.77–0.87) | 22.7 | 71 | 80 | 70 | 80 | 76 |
dbp | 0.77 (0.71–0.83) | 20.6 | 58 | 85 | 72 | 75 | 74 |
cpp | 0.73 (0.65–0.81) | 24.6 | 74 | 68 | 71 | 71 | 71 |
hr | 0.83 (0.78–0.89) | 23.0 | 82 | 73 | 68 | 86 | 77 |
icp | 0.77 (0.70–0.85) | 19.6 | 83 | 62 | 70 | 78 | 73 |
amp | 0.71 (0.62–0.79) | 22.2 | 81 | 56 | 66 | 73 | 68 |
Based on the univariable MSE ROC the different AUCs as well as the corresponding Youden Index based optimal threshold, sensitivity, specificity, positive and negative predictive values, overall accuracy are shown
aABP mean arterial blood pressure, AMP intracranial pressure amplitude, AUC area under the curve, CI confidence interval, CPP cerebral perfusion pressure, DBP diastolic blood pressure, HR heart rate, ICP intracranial pressure, MSE multiscale entropy, NPV negative predictive value, PPV positive predictive value, SBP systolic blood pressure
